    MMA Global India launches AI Advisory

    Mumbai: MMA Global India proudly announces the inauguration of the MMA Global India AI Advisory, a collaborative effort uniting the marketing ecosystem comprising members such as McDonald’s, HP, Microsoft, EY, ReBid, SAS, Netcore, Airtel, Aditya Birla Group, Tata Consumer Products, Bridgestone, CEAT, HDFC Bank, ICICI Bank, L’Oreal India, Mondelez, MakeMyTrip, and many others.

    Why AI Advisory?

    The subject of AI is fast-evolving, and keeping up with the pace can be challenging. The MMA Global India AI Advisory is here to provide the right platform for industry representatives to discuss challenges, engage in knowledge sharing, and drive collaboration for growth.

    “With 3 out of 4 companies already experimenting and scaling, especially in areas like marketing optimization and personalization, our AI Advisory will serve as a compass to enable marketers to harness intelligence and propel innovation. I wish to welcome our AI advisory members and the industry to help shape the future of AI in marketing and together tread the path to AI-powered marketing,” shared MMA Global India country head and board member Moneka Khurana. She further added that “this council serves as a testament to our commitment to fostering collaboration, knowledge sharing, and pushing the boundaries of AI applications in the Indian marketing landscape.”

    Objective of the AI Advisory:

    The AI Advisory at MMA Global India is committed to driving the adoption of AI applications in marketing at scale. It represents a working coalition of leading marketers and thought leaders focused on applying AI to marketing responsibly and effectively.

    What Sets the Advisory Apart:

    With a special focus on the Indian market, the MMA Global India AI Advisory ensures marketers have access to relevant content and resources needed to be at the forefront of technological innovation.

    Ernst & Young, head & partner and marketing advisory Amiya Swaru sharing his excitement for the launch, said, “The MMA India AI Advisory is a significant initiative; and a commitment to drive effective AI integration in marketing. Through thought leadership, the AI Advisory’s objective is to enable marketers to deliver business goals using effective use of AI and technology.”

    Dentsu acquires French cross-activation agency ZoneFranche

    MUMBAI: Dentsu Aegis Network has acquired the Paris based cross-activation agency ZoneFranche SAS, which has strengths in experiential marketing.

     

    Founded in 2004, ZoneFranche has steadily captured an increasing share of the growing activation market, and is currently one of the leading agencies with a focus on consumer brand experience and experienced value.

     

    The company also offers a wide range of communications services including digital, mobile, advertising and promotion solutions that leverage social media, customer relationship management (CRM), and other marketing activities to enhance the purchasing experience. These innovative, high-quality services have earned it high praise from prominent companies in France as well as in other countries.

     

    Post-acquisition, ZoneFranche will become part of experiential marketing agency psLIVE, one of the Dentsu Group’s specialist brands. During the next 12 months, psLIVE will be realigned as MKTG, the Group’s lifestyle marketing brand headquartered in New York and one of its nine global network brands.

     

    As was reported earlier by Indiantelevision.com, in India Dentsu recently acquired Brian Tellis’ Fountainhead Entertainment, which will be merged with psLIVE.
